eAgreements – The Future of Digital Contract Management

In today`s digitally-driven world, businesses and individuals are increasingly relying on electronic agreements (eAgreements) for their contract management needs. These agreements are legal documents that are created, signed, and stored digitally. They are gaining popularity, especially in the wake of the pandemic, as they offer numerous benefits over traditional paper-based contracts, such as cost savings, speed, and convenience.

What is an eAgreement?

An eAgreement is a legally binding contract that is created, signed, and stored electronically. Similar to a paper-based agreement, an eAgreement outlines the rights and obligations of the parties involved in a contract. It defines the terms of the agreement, including the responsibilities of each party, payment details, delivery timelines, and any other relevant information.

Types of eAgreements

There are several types of eAgreements, such as:

1. Clickwrap Agreements – These are agreements that users accept by clicking on a button or checking a box. They are commonly used in software licenses, mobile apps, and online purchases.

2. Browsewrap Agreements – These agreements are generally found at the bottom of a website or on a separate page and can be agreed to by continued use of the website or service.

3. Sign-in Wrapped Agreements – These agreements are generally used when users sign up for a service or create an account.

4. Hybrid Agreements – These agreements combine elements of both clickwrap and browsewrap agreements.

Benefits of eAgreements

1. Cost Savings – eAgreements reduce the cost of contract management. Businesses no longer need to spend money on printing, postage, and storage costs associated with paper-based contracts.

2. Improved Efficiency – eAgreements speed up the contract negotiation process. They can be executed in minutes, and parties can sign contracts from anywhere, at any time.

3. Reduced Environmental Impact – eAgreements eliminate the need for paper-based contracts, which reduces the environmental impact of contract management.

4. Enhanced Security – eAgreements offer enhanced security compared to paper-based contracts. Digital signatures, encryption, and audit trails ensure the integrity and authenticity of the contract.

5. Improved Contract Management – eAgreements provide better contract management by enabling easy access, tracking, and administration of contracts.
